Connect with us

Movie & TV Trailers

Chupa – Official Trailer (2023) Demián Bichir, Evan Whitten, Christian Slater



Check out the trailer for Chupa, an upcoming movie starring Demián Bichir, Evan Whitten, Christian Slater, Ashley Ciarra, …

source